Overview
- Over the weekend, a man in his 70s exchanged explicit images during an online chat with a purported woman.
- Shortly afterward, a fake social‑media account demanded money and threatened to publish the images if he refused.
- The victim reported the incident to the district police authority, which has opened an investigation that remains ongoing.
- Police urged the public to avoid sharing sensitive content with strangers and to save chats and screenshots as evidence.
- Officials emphasized that sending money rarely ends the scheme and often results in repeated extortion attempts.
